Word "DATELINE" Definitions:


Part of Speech:
Noun
Definition:
an imaginary line on the surface of the earth following (approximately) the 180th meridian
Synonyms:
date line, international date line

Part of Speech:
Verb
Definition:
mark with a date and place
Synonyms:
date-mark, datemark
Examples:
dateline a newspaper article

Part of Speech:
Noun
Definition:
a line at the beginning of a news article giving the date and place of origin of the news dispatch
